
Nadia Romero Biography and Wiki
Nadia Romero is an American Award-winning journalist and news personality working as a national correspondent for CNN News based in Atlanta, Georgia. Prior to that, she served at the CNN NEWSOURCE in Washington D.C., as a correspondent.

Nadia Romero Career
Nadia works as a national correspondent for CNN News based in Atlanta, Georgia. Prior to that, she served at the CNN NEWSOURCE in Washington D.C., as a correspondent.
Before joining CNN in August 2019, she worked as an anchor and reporter at KCPQ-TV Q13 FOX. She has also served as an anchor at KTVX ABC 4 in Utah.
Romero has served at KCRG TV9 in Cedar Rapids; WSJV FOX 28 in Elkhart, IN; and as a weekend reporter for WSYR News Channel 9 in Syracuse.
In Addition, she was the first black primary anchor in Utah and was featured in ESSENCE magazine and on the Meredith Vieira Show.
